罗技鼠标宏编程是根据什么语言
-
罗技鼠标宏编程是根据罗技自家开发的一种宏命令语言。这种语言可以让用户通过编写一系列指令来实现自定义的鼠标功能。在罗技鼠标宏编程中,用户可以使用简单的脚本语言来编写宏命令,这些命令可以包括鼠标移动、点击、滚动、键盘输入等操作。用户可以通过录制鼠标和键盘的操作来自动生成宏命令,也可以手动编写宏命令来实现更复杂的功能。罗技鼠标宏编程语言的语法相对简单易懂,用户只需要了解一些基本的命令和函数即可开始编写自己的宏命令。通过罗技鼠标宏编程,用户可以大大提高鼠标的效率和便捷性,实现一键执行多个操作的功能。总之,罗技鼠标宏编程是一种方便实用的功能,可以根据用户的需求来实现个性化的鼠标操作。
1年前 -
罗技鼠标宏编程是基于罗技自家的宏编程语言Lua进行的。Lua是一种轻量级的脚本语言,被广泛用于嵌入式系统和游戏开发中。罗技鼠标宏编程使用Lua语言来编写和编辑宏脚本,以实现对鼠标的自定义功能和操作。Lua语言简洁而灵活,易于学习和使用,可以满足大多数用户的需求。
-
简洁易学:Lua语言是一种简洁而灵活的脚本语言,语法简单且易于学习和使用。即使是没有编程经验的用户也可以很快上手。
-
高度可定制化:通过使用Lua语言编写宏脚本,用户可以根据自己的需求对鼠标进行高度定制化的操作。可以定义鼠标按键的功能、快捷键、宏命令等,满足个性化的操作需求。
-
强大的功能扩展性:Lua语言具有强大的功能扩展性,用户可以通过编写自定义函数和脚本来扩展罗技鼠标的功能。可以实现复杂的操作逻辑和算法,满足更高级的需求。
-
灵活的脚本编辑器:罗技鼠标宏编程提供了一个灵活的脚本编辑器,用户可以在其中编写和编辑Lua脚本。编辑器提供了语法高亮、代码提示、调试等功能,方便用户进行脚本的编写和调试。
-
大量的宏模板和示例:罗技鼠标宏编程提供了大量的宏模板和示例供用户参考和使用。用户可以直接使用这些模板和示例,或者根据自己的需求进行修改和定制,快速实现所需功能。
1年前 -
-
罗技鼠标宏编程是基于Lua语言的。Lua是一种轻量级的脚本语言,特点是简洁、高效、可嵌入,被广泛应用于游戏开发、嵌入式系统和脚本扩展等领域。罗技鼠标的宏编程功能就是利用Lua语言来编写和执行宏脚本。
Lua语言具有简单易学的特点,语法简洁清晰,支持面向过程和面向对象的编程范式,同时还提供了丰富的库函数和扩展性。因此,使用Lua语言进行罗技鼠标宏编程可以很方便地实现各种功能和操作。
在罗技鼠标宏编程中,用户可以通过罗技宏编程软件(如Logitech Gaming Software或G HUB)创建和编辑宏脚本。用户可以使用软件提供的图形化界面来录制鼠标的操作,也可以手动编写Lua脚本来实现更复杂的功能。
下面是一个简单的例子,展示了如何使用Lua语言编写一个罗技鼠标宏脚本:
function OnEvent(event, arg) if event == "MOUSE_BUTTON_PRESSED" and arg == 4 then -- 按下鼠标按钮4时执行以下操作 PressKey("A") -- 按下键盘上的A键 Sleep(50) -- 等待50毫秒 ReleaseKey("A") -- 松开键盘上的A键 end end上述代码中,通过定义一个名为OnEvent的函数来处理鼠标事件。当鼠标按钮4被按下时,该函数会执行按下A键、等待50毫秒、松开A键的操作。
除了模拟键盘按键,Lua语言还支持其他丰富的功能,如模拟鼠标移动、滚轮滚动、延时等。通过灵活运用Lua语言,用户可以编写出各种复杂的宏脚本,实现自己想要的操作和功能。
1年前